The 1 topic that has been bugging me for the past few months is the correlation between the large Ebay sellers / large PSA/BGS submitters and the occurance of over-graded cards. I, like others, have purchased PSA 10's on Ebay and received cards with noticeable corner issues. I'm trying to find out if my suspicion is just my own paranoia or if others suspect this too.
This was my last attempt at PSA to discuss this issue. The thread got locked in about 20 minutes today "This thread may get blown up, but thats OK. Perhaps I'm too much of a skeptic, but I think its time to start talking about the REAL issue in collecting modern graded cards today, which has nothing to do with shilling on Ebay. Why is it that some large Ebay sellers are able to consistently get PSA 10 grades on cards that are often PSA 8 quality? I'll name names....its relevant to the conversation. I've received cards from 4SC in the past with noticeable corner issues. Cards that I wouldn't have even bothered to submit. That shouldn't happen in a PSA 10 holder and its happened more than once with 4SC. Are these just the 1 in 1,000 example of the grader missing something or is something else going on? Have others had issues with cards of questionable quality from this seller or other large submitters?" |

I too was involved in the thread that just got locked over there....lol. It's pretty ridiculous to think that someone could get 97% 10's on 60's and 70's low pop psa 10 cards when I know that you or I could not open up brand new present day cards and not have near that success rate with 10's. If there wasn't something very wrong going on then they wouldn't have a problem with an open discussion about it. I have never even heard of anything remotely close to that success rate on 10's of any year or any brand, so a sub like that filled with 40-50 year old cards where the quality control wasn't near what it is with modern cards is pretty suspicious to put it very nicely.
